Transaction 6849541399313e5bd36bd293862d50cd8a60bd6e7977d6c5c303a4ab6cc3632c
1 Input
1 Output
-
6849541399313e5bd36bd293862d50cd8a60bd6e7977d6c5c303a4ab6cc3632c:0
- value
- 1431654
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 907d1fb5fc096826a2d87612d8c7655c7e389951 OP_EQUAL
- address
- 3Es17vgFGzQF5NFoCJxEQ562KatNgmXGcK